Merge branch 'for-3.6' of git://git.kernel.org/pub/scm/linux/kernel/git/tj/cgroup

Pull cgroup changes from Tejun Heo:
 "Nothing too interesting.  A minor bug fix and some cleanups."

* 'for-3.6' of git://git.kernel.org/pub/scm/linux/kernel/git/tj/cgroup:
  cgroup: Update remount documentation
  cgroup: cgroup_rm_files() was calling simple_unlink() with the wrong inode
  cgroup: Remove populate() documentation
  cgroup: remove hierarchy_mutex
